10 DESIGN007 MAGAZINE I JUNE 2025 Feature Interview by Andy Shaughnessy I-CONNECT007 Maybe you've never liked autorouters; if so, you're not alone. As Andy Buja, Zuken's technical account manager for PCB Solutions, admits, autorouters are not perfect. But today's autorouters allow designers a greater level of control than ever before, especially routers that incorporate collaborative AI. In this interview, Andy discusses Zuken's drive to integrate AI into its autorouting tech- nology, and why this new generation of auto- routers might finally break through with the greater PCB design community. Andy Shaughnessy: You have been updating and adding functionality to your autorouters. What is Zuken's autorouter technology, and how can it help designers address complex and high-speed challenges? Andy Buja: At Zuken, we've always seen auto- routing not as a one-size-fits-all solution, but as a set of smart tools that support the designer's strategy, especially in high-speed, high-density designs. Our approach allows engineers to selectively apply automation where it provides the most value, without sacrificing control. Zuken Autorouters Embrace Collaborative AI
